"A BEAUTIFUL BLEND OF THE GOOD AND THE GREAT"
Parampoojya M.R. Gopalacharya , founder of the Vani
Vihar Sanskrit Mahavidyalaya and the moving spirit
behind Satyadhyana Vidyapeetha , Mumbai needs no
introduction.
Born on December 15 1909, Shri Gopalacharya belongs
to the well known "Mahuli" family of Vaishnavas of
Jayantinagara (Ainapur) whose scions have been
reputed for generation for their Sanskrit education,
in particular vedic lore and literature. His
traditional Sanskrit education did not suffer in the
least, although he had his English education
simultaneously. In fact the two proceeded together
untill he took his M.A. degree in both Sanskrit and
English literature imbibing the best in both
oriental and occidental learning.
With this high acedemical equipment. He could have
got a professors job in any university for mere
asking. But he was not the type to be tempted by
such cheap materialistic rewards. Instead he
sedulously strove and consolidated what he already
learned from others at the feet of His Holiness Sri
Satyadhyana Tirtha Swamiji. of hallowed memory and
acquired proficiency in every branch of Sanskrit
lore.
One can not be truly erudite in this lore without
plumbing all its branches Nyaya, Vedanata and
Alankara and also the vast expanse of literature ,
Vedic and Classical. Learned Gopalacharya owes this
all as he never misses to maintain, to that
illustrious leader of philosophical thought , His
holiness Sri Satyadhyana Teertha Swamiji. He has
brought out innumerable monographs and edited more
than two scores of old Vedantic works. But for his
indefatigable effort and assiduous application ,
these valuable works could not have seen the light
of the day. The most outstanding of his work to-date
acknowledged by eminent foreigners as a great
contribution to our vedic literature, however, has
been "The Heart of the Rigveda".
It was Shri Acharya's ardent desire and firm
determination to start and run a Sanskrit Pathashala
on our ancient Gurukula lines. In furtherance of
this desire, he founded as far back as in 1937 Vani
Vihar Sanskrit Maha Vidyalaya. The vidyalaya of
which he is the kulpati, has been rendering the
signal service by imaprting free learning in all
branches of sanskrit.

Shri Gopalacharya's educational activities are by no
means confined to Vidyalaya and Vidyapeetha. A
monumental service of his to the society at large
takes the form of his lucid and learned discourses
on the Bhagavad Gita and the Bhagavata in Mumbai adn
